Transaction d81c71093ee30c7bb47efaf75b80381404c94298ceb5eb2f46aa4fe40a28539c

2 Input
2 Outputs
  • d81c71093ee30c7bb47efaf75b80381404c94298ceb5eb2f46aa4fe40a28539c:0
  • value  2142486
    address  37DfXh71gRhMPeDfXqa1vRHtrHNrqJfrqG
  • d81c71093ee30c7bb47efaf75b80381404c94298ceb5eb2f46aa4fe40a28539c:1
  • value  3390605
    address  3LqebsjhZX57xe7nx5JsiaRus6xtEz6ATE